使用CDN部署静态资源有哪些优势和注意事项

简介: 使用CDN部署静态资源能显著加速内容传递、减轻源服务器负载、提高可用性和容错性、节省带宽成本。但需选择合适的CDN提供商,合理配置缓存规则,确保安全性,监控性能,优化策略,避免缓存污染和处理资源版本问题,以实现最优效果。

使用CDN部署静态资源可以带来多方面的优势,但同时也需要注意一些问题以确保顺利实施和最优效果。

优势

  1. 加速内容传递:CDN通过全球分布的节点,使用户可以从最近的节点获取资源,减少延迟和传输时间,显著提高网站加载速度。
  2. 减轻源服务器负载:静态资源缓存在CDN节点上,减轻了源服务器的处理压力,提高了网站的可扩展性和稳定性。
  3. 提高可用性和容错性:CDN的多节点部署保证了即使某个节点出现故障,用户也能从其他节点获取内容,增强了网站的高可用性和容错性。
  4. 节省带宽成本:通过智能分配和缓存内容,CDN减少了对原始服务器的带宽使用,从而降低了成本。

注意事项

  1. 选择合适的CDN提供商:不同的CDN提供商在服务、费用、网络覆盖范围等方面可能有所不同,需要根据具体需求进行选择。
  2. 配置缓存规则:合理设置缓存时间和策略,以减少回源请求并提高访问速度。
  3. 安全性考虑:确保CDN提供商提供足够的安全措施,如HTTPS支持和DDoS攻击防护,并考虑用户数据的隐私保护。
  4. 监控和日志分析:利用CDN提供商的监控和日志功能,实时了解CDN的运行状态和性能表现,以便及时优化。
  5. 优化策略:根据CDN提供商的建议和最佳实践,优化静态资源的加载和传输方式,提高网站性能。
  6. 避免缓存污染:确保更新静态资源时,旧资源能够被有效清除或替换,避免用户访问到过时的资源。
  7. 处理资源版本问题:在资源更新时,合理使用资源版本号或哈希值来控制资源的缓存和更新,确保用户总是获取到最新版本的资源。

通过合理利用CDN的优势并注意实施过程中的问题,可以有效地提升静态资源的分发效率和用户体验。

相关文章
|
6月前
|
缓存 安全 搜索推荐
CDN是什么?使用CDN有什么优势?
在维护和提供高质量网站服务时,CDN是不可或缺的工具之一,能够显著提升用户体验,降低网站运营成本,并增强网站的可靠性和安全性。尤其对于需要快速可靠内容交付的服务至关重要,如媒体公司、电子商务平台及在线教育提供商等。通过使用CDN,这些组织能够在全球范围内提供即时、优化的用户体验,这是在今天这个需要快速获取信息的时代极为重要的。
298 3
|
弹性计算 缓存 运维
【运维知识进阶篇】用阿里云部署kod可道云网盘(DNS解析+CDN缓存+Web应用防火墙+弹性伸缩)(三)
【运维知识进阶篇】用阿里云部署kod可道云网盘(DNS解析+CDN缓存+Web应用防火墙+弹性伸缩)(三)
435 0
|
缓存 监控 网络安全
使用CDN部署静态资源有哪些优势和注意事项?
使用CDN部署静态资源有哪些优势和注意事项?
|
前端开发 JavaScript 开发工具
使用jsDelivr和GitHub,上传本地静态资源到免费CDN
本文介绍了一种将本地图片和静态资源(如 js、css、文档等)上传至免费CDN的方法,便于随时调用。具体步骤包括:在GitHub创建仓库`resources`存放资源;通过上传或Git命令同步文件;在仓库中创建新版本并发布。之后即可通过指定格式的URL访问这些CDN资源。此方法简单高效,适合开发者快速部署和共享静态内容。
1219 5
使用jsDelivr和GitHub,上传本地静态资源到免费CDN
|
缓存 监控 网络安全
CDN部署静态资源有哪些优势和注意事项
CDN部署静态资源有哪些优势和注意事项
|
弹性计算 Serverless API
Serverless 应用引擎产品使用合集之如何设置静态资源的CDN
阿里云Serverless 应用引擎(SAE)提供了完整的微服务应用生命周期管理能力,包括应用部署、服务治理、开发运维、资源管理等功能,并通过扩展功能支持多环境管理、API Gateway、事件驱动等高级应用场景,帮助企业快速构建、部署、运维和扩展微服务架构,实现Serverless化的应用部署与运维模式。以下是对SAE产品使用合集的概述,包括应用管理、服务治理、开发运维、资源管理等方面。
|
3月前
|
缓存 前端开发 JavaScript
适合阿里云CDN分发的文件类型有哪些?
静态文件如网页、图片、视频等适合CDN分发,可提升加载速度,减轻源站压力。动态、私有或频繁变更内容则不适合。合理选择资源包,助力高效上云。
|
3月前
|
CDN
阿里云CDN计费价格如何收费的?一文看懂
阿里云CDN计费包含基础费用与增值服务。基础费用可选按流量、带宽峰值或月结95带宽计费,默认按流量计费;增值服务如HTTPS、QUIC、WAF、实时日志等按使用量收费,不使用不计费。支持资源包抵扣,详情参考官方文档。
505 10
|
3月前
|
缓存 监控 安全
如何设置阿里云CDN的流量阈值以避免超额费用?
在信息爆炸时代,阿里云CDN助力网站加速。合理设置CDN阈值可提升性能、节省带宽、增强安全。本文详解阈值配置步骤与监控优化,助你高效利用资源。无账号者可通过翼龙云上云,享技术支持与优惠。